Transaction 81ebd587fe7496df91e7d98a61e66e501204548f4474c814fc3254a31c0b114c
1 Input
2 Outputs
- 81ebd587fe7496df91e7d98a61e66e501204548f4474c814fc3254a31c0b114c:0
- 81ebd587fe7496df91e7d98a61e66e501204548f4474c814fc3254a31c0b114c:1
value 779009
address 31sFiPB2gyaVpBDssgKM4h1vNptjpLyeag
value 792795
address 19FCKHZVKqzxph4gyZjjZGYnCW5XTbj1hn